Description JOB SUMMARY Under immediate supervision, to work with and assist a Power Plant Technician - Gas Turbine receiving increasing instruction and experience in the maintenance and operation of gas turbine power plants. Examples of Duties D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ES Work with and assist a Power Plant Technician - Gas Turbine. During training, perform progressively more difficult and technical duties.

Assist in the inspection, maintenance and operation of gas turbine power plant and associated equipment such as hydraulic activators, lubrication oil systems, generator cooling water systems, generators and turbines, station batteries, switchboard, water treatment systems, fuel handling systems, etc. Meggering and high pot testing. Check and record exciter generator brush condition.

Assist in the maintenance and operation of other power plants. Perform welding and fabrication work. Operate radio and telephone equipment.

Assist in similar activities at other power operating stations mainly hydro power plants. Assist in the maintenance of a variety of records including those for the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ission, Air Quality Control Board or other governing agencies. Respond to emergency situations and be on call as assigned.

Perform other related duties as required or assigned by supervisor. Typical Qualifications QUALIFICATIONS Any combination of experience and education that would likely provide the required skills and abilities is qualifying. A typical way to obtain the skills and abilities would be: Education Equivalent to completion of the twelfth grade.

Experience None required. Skills and Abilities Interpersonal and Communication. Ability to: follow oral and written instructions; and establish and maintain cooperative relationships with those contacted in the course of work.

Technical and Analytical. Ability to: analyze problems logically; read and interpret plans and specifications; and keep records and prepare reports. Knowledge of: basic electricity and electronics; basic mechanical and hydraulic principles; and mathematics including a basic understanding of algebra, geometry and trigonometry.

Supplemental Information Necessary Special Requirements Possession of an appropriate California driver's license. Must furnish own hand tools. Must be able to respond quickly to emergency calls.

This classification will be required to work a scheduled on call period. Employees who are assigned an on-call period have a response time obligation as listed below: An on-call Apprentice Power Plant Technician - Gas Turbine must be able to arrive at the Almond Power Plant within thirty (30) minutes of the time they are called out.
